Output 69e4af747fc9764f83a3f54df28fea45b8d12ae83d02028514939b0bd09affae:19

value
42357500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db24216cdac58b1f62e1ca4607b305ca0d6c3013 OP_EQUAL
address
MTssVqVVQKxac2YaoESpUdXpfpj3foJJWm
transaction
69e4af747fc9764f83a3f54df28fea45b8d12ae83d02028514939b0bd09affae
spent
true